Justin Bieber was left momentarily red-faced on Wednesday's Today Show (23 November 2011) after flubbing the lines to the Christmas hit 'Santa Claus Is Coming to Town'. The 17-year-old was performing the holiday ditty surrounded by hundreds of screaming fans, some of whom may have taken his mind off the lyrics.
According to the New York Post, the singer gave the song the rap treatment - a version that features on his new festive album as well as the Ardman studios animated movie 'Arthur Christmas'. Backed by a string of dancers, Justin blanked out on several lines of the song, instead repeating the lines, "He's making a list" and" "He sees you when you're sleeping". Taking to the stage in a festive cardigan, Bieber may have been excused for fluffing his lines, given the amount of attention he was receiving from the screaming fans, some of whom had camped out all night to catch a glimpse of their idol. The performance also helped to cool reports that Justin favours lip synching for one-off shows - something he was accused of following his appearance at the 2010 Vma Awards. On that occasion, the singer never publically commented on the matter.
